Definition and Explanation

Damages and Life Care Planning refers to calculating financial recovery for medical expenses, lost wages, and long term support needs. It also includes creating a plan that outlines required medical care, home modifications, and daily assistance to help a Stevens Johnson Syndrome patient live as independently as possible.

Glossary Term: Life Care Plan

A life care plan is a comprehensive, forward looking document that outlines anticipated medical care, therapies, equipment, home modifications, and supportive services a patient will require over their lifetime. It includes estimated costs, funding sources, and a timeline to help families prepare and plan for ongoing needs.

Glossary Term: Home Modifications

Home modifications refer to changes made to a residence to improve safety and accessibility for someone with ongoing medical needs. This term covers structural alterations, equipment installations, and supportive features that enable daily living and reduce the risk of further injury or complications.

Glossary Term: Medical Costs

Medical costs include current and projected expenses for treatments, hospital stays, medications, therapies, and follow up care. This term also covers associated services such as transportation to appointments and specialized equipment required for recovery and daily functioning.

Glossary Term: Funding Sources

Funding sources encompass insurance benefits, government programs, settlements, and other means of financial support that can cover medical care, life care services, and related costs. This term explains how to identify and access these resources as part of a recovery plan.

Service Pro Tips

Document medical history and ongoing needs

Keep a detailed record of medical treatments, therapies, prescriptions, and any supportive services received. Organize records by date and provider, and maintain copies of test results, care plans, and receipts. This thorough documentation helps create an accurate picture of future care needs and supports a solid damages claim.

Track all care costs and funding sources

Create a ledger of medical expenses, equipment purchases, home modifications, transportation, and any non medical costs related to care. Identify potential funding sources such as insurance benefits, government programs, and settlements, and monitor changes in coverage that may impact the plan.

Coordinate with care planners and your legal team

Maintain open communication with your attorney, medical professionals, and caregivers. Share updates on health status, new therapies, or changes in living arrangements. A collaborative approach helps ensure the life care plan remains current and aligned with evolving needs.

Stevens-Johnson syndrome (SJS) represents a severe and potentially life-threatening condition that impacts the skin and mucous membranes. When this condition progresses to its most dangerous variant, toxic epidermal necrolysis (TEN), mortality rates can range from 30-80%. In most cases, these reactions stem from adverse responses to pharmaceutical medications.
